Unlimited Mobile broadband

If you wanted a short term unlimited mobile broadband package is it even possible.

There seem to be networks providing like 5GB/month with 1 month min contract. But that may not be enough for some users, esp if your watching movies or downloading big files.

Normal broadband requires line rental, which means having to pay BT line activation and then a long term commitment for affordable prices.

So what is the best option for unlimited (or as much data as possible) internet access without long term commitments, for example 3 months?

    I'm pretty sure plusnet do a have rolling monthly line rental contract option, with their broadband.

    Tbh, 3G mobile broadband is not really suited to streaming, the usage can be low, and it can at times be to slow. Often and not with these unlimited packages they may throttle (except the one plan from three, for about £25 a month).

  • The data limit for The One Plan on three is around 69GB which you're unlikely to breach. I've been using it as my main internet for over two years now.

    The One Plan includes tethering so there is no problem hooking up a PC to it.

    As for speeds, it varies depending on the time of day but I get between 10 M/Bs and 25 MB/s which fast enough to stream HD to a couple of devices.
